Position Overview

As an Assembler your job duties may include installing decking/flooring, fencing on pontoons, seating, consoles, wiring, and more.

Essential Functions
  • Must possess the desire and ambition to work safely at all times, and report all hazards to their Supervisor immediately
  • Ability to understand and follow Standard Operating Procedures, Work Instructions, and Engineering Prints
  • Visually inspect and/or audit units for quality
  • Discuss quality issues with lead or supervisor to resolve problems
  • Use a variety of electric and pneumatic hand tools
  • Seek positive solutions to issues and problems
  • Must be able to complete work within takt time
  • Keep work area clean and organized
  • Maintain a high standard of conduct and comply with company policies and procedures
  • Perform other duties as assigned
Required Qualifications
  • Must be able to wear required personal protective equipment where designated, including but not limited to: safety glasses, hearing protection, gloves, sleeves, etc.
  • Must be flexible to work extended hours to support the requirements of the business
  • Experience using basic hand and small power tools including drill, saws, sanders, measuring tape, level, etc.
  • Must be able to read a blueprint
  • Previous manufacturing and/or machinery experience preferred
  • Must be able to communicate and work in a team environment
  • Demonstrate basic computer skills
Working Conditions

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ently standing and lifting heavy objects weighing 50 to 100 pounds. The employee is constantly walking, pushing/pulling, reaching, and climbing stairs. The employee is occasionally squatting, kneeling, and using fine hand movements such as tightening screws, bolts, and securing pins. Specific vision requirements include close vision, peripheral vision, and ability to adjust.
